MANAGEMENT AND PROGRAM ANALYST

This is a GG-12 position in the Defense Civilian Intelligence personnel System (DCIPS). The GG-12 duties for the Professional work category are at the Full Performance work level and are equivalent to those at the GS-12 level. The selectee's salary will be set within the grade equivalent to a GS/GG grade based on the selectee's qualifications in relation to the job. In order to qualify, you must meet the specialized experience requirements described in the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) Qualification Standards for General Schedule Positions, Administrative and Management positions. Your qualifications will be evaluated on the basis of your level of knowledge, skills, abilities and/or competencies in the following areas:
1. Knowledge training principles, concepts, and methods; as well as wide range of qualitative and/or quantitative methods to develop cyberspace and intelligence training programs. 2. Practical knowledge of funds management, budget procedures, and regulations governing APDP professional development and training activities. 3. Skill in applying standard qualitative and quantitative techniques sufficient to carry out assigned projects and studies. 4. Ability to gather facts and use effective, analytical, and evaluative methods to accurately assess information and make sound decisions and recommendations. 5. Ability to communicate effectively, both orally and in writing. 6. Knowledge of federal organizations, agencies, and Department of Defense (DoD), involved with and responsible for Cyber policy formulation and implementation as it applies to USAF Cyber missions. Knowledge of security practices for ensuring the safeguarding of classified information. PART-TIME OR UNPAID

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
